Comfort
A high-quality double 3 wheeler pushchair should be comfortable for the baby and the parent. It should have a comfortable seat and the hood should cover both their heads. You can also find an array of colours and fabrics, as well as accessories to fit your preferences. Certain models come with a lie flat mode for babies and most models feature different positions that recline. Some models are lighter, making it easier to move them into the car as well as up and down kerbs.
Look for features that will make your ride more comfortable, such as a soft suspension or a large basket. Some models have a frame that expands in width to accommodate a second seating position. This lets them fit through narrow doorways and are also easier to maneuver on rough terrain. Some have a sleek standing fold that takes up less room in storage between uses and some models even include an rucksack that can be used for transporting the buggy.
Side-by-side buggies are typically bigger than single buggies, however some, such as the Roma Gemini, manage to be lighter but still have enough nippy feel to be used in urban areas or in theme parks. Due to their evenly weight distribution, they are also easier to maneuver up and down kerbs, compared to other twin-seaters. They can be used by babies as young as four years old. old. Some have the option to attach carrycots or car seats to extend their life.
Some can even convert to a trio of kids by incorporating a buggy board for older children who are mobile (UPPAbaby Vist v2 Double). It's important to note that although the majority of manufacturers stipulate a maximum weight per seat and perhaps the frame's total weight, it's impossible to know how much your children will grow until they reach toddler age.
Ultimately, a great method to determine if an oversized double pushchair will work for you is to test it out in person, so that you can be able to see how it's simple to maneuver with both children in the seat. Ask the store if they're able to offer a demo or hire agreement to help you get a better feel for a model.

Safety
A double pushchair 3 wheeler will give you a lot more stability than your average four-wheeled model, making it a safer choice when you frequently walk through the countryside. Regular pushchairs with small wheels are prone to getting clogged with sticks, grass and mud, making them difficult to navigate. On the other hand a double pushchair that has three wheels has large back wheels that occupy the bulk of the space, meaning you're less likely to trip over anything.
All-terrain pushchairs, like the Roma Gemini, are a excellent choice for those who live in an area that has a lot of bumpy and rough terrain. This model comes with large, puncture-resistant all-terrain tires and a sturdy suspension that allows it to navigate any surface without any issues. The UPPAbaby Vista 2 is also capable of handling any terrain and can be used by twins or a toddlers with a 'PiggyBack Board' (sold separately).
The Bugaboo Fox 5 is another great model of a pushchair that is all-terrain. It's ideal for jogging once your child is old enough thanks to its tyres that are filled with air and suspension. However, it's worth remembering that these types of pushchairs are a little heavier than standard models and can be a bit heavy to fold. Therefore, it's best to use them for long, strenuous walks over different kinds of terrain rather than for nipping around the city.
